South Hardin is  a perfect 3-0 against Central Springs since October of 2020 and they'll have a chance to extend that dominance on Friday. The Tigers will square off against the Panthers at 7:00  p.m. Central Springs took a loss in their last  game and will be looking to turn the tables on South Hardin, who comes in off a win.
South Hardin's defense heads into the  matchup  hoping to repeat the dominance they displayed  on Friday. They breezed past Clarion-Goldfield/DOWS to the tune of  29-0. Considering the Tigers have won six contests by more than 20  points this season, Friday's  blowout was nothing new.

It was another big night for  Kameron Adams, who rushed for 168 yards and three  TDs. His rushing production has been exceptional  recently as that marked his fourth straight game with at least 156  rushing yards.
 South Hardin didn't go easy on the quarterback and picked off two passes before the game was over. The picks came courtesy of  Sawyer Kane and  Casey Williamson.
 Meanwhile, Central Springs fell victim to Grundy Center and their airtight defense  on Friday. They were dealt  a  55-0 loss at the hands of the Spartans. While losing is never fun, the Panthers can't take it too hard given the team's big disadvantage  in MaxPreps' Iowa football rankings (they are ranked 210th, while the Spartans are ranked 12th).
 South Hardin's victory was  their fifth straight at home dating back to last season, which  pushed their record up to 6-1. The  home  wins came thanks in part to their offensive performance across that stretch, as  they  averaged 36.6 points over those games. As for Central Springs, they now  have a losing record of 3-4.
 Everything went South Hardin's way against Central Springs in their previous meeting  back in September of 2022, as South Hardin made off with  a  46-21 victory. In that  game, the Tigers amassed a halftime lead of  39-14, an impressive feat they'll look to repeat  on Friday.
